High-precision indoor and outdoor navigator fused with Beidou GPS
By integrating BeiDou and GPS into a high-precision indoor and outdoor navigation system, synchronous acquisition and processing of BeiDou and GPS signals, dynamic weight allocation and differential enhancement are achieved. This solves the problems of insufficient spatiotemporal reference alignment, signal acquisition and preprocessing capabilities of existing equipment, improves positioning accuracy and stability, and adapts to seamless navigation across the entire domain.

AI Technical Summary
Existing BeiDou/GPS dual-mode navigation devices have shortcomings in spatiotemporal reference alignment accuracy, signal acquisition and preprocessing capabilities, and differential enhancement adaptability, resulting in insufficient positioning accuracy and stability, and failing to meet the requirements for seamless, high-precision navigation across the entire domain.
The system employs a dual-mode signal acquisition module, a spatiotemporal reference registration module, a scene feature perception module, a fusion weight calculation module, and a positioning coordinate output module to achieve synchronous acquisition and processing of BeiDou and GPS signals, dynamic weight allocation and differential enhancement, and full-domain coordinate calculation and output.
It improves the positioning accuracy of dual-system fusion, maintains the stability of positioning performance in weak signal scenarios, achieves seamless switching and continuous coverage between indoor and outdoor scenarios, and adapts to the high-precision navigation needs of multiple industries.
